Cell death plays a central role in the development of many diseases The research in my laboratory focuses on understanding the molecular mechanisms of programmed cell death (apoptosis) and developing new selective therapeutic agents for inhibition of apoptotic proteins for the treatment of cancer using cytotoxic assays, q-PCR, and atomic force microscopes Also, I studied the mode of binding of the inorganic complex with Calf thymus DNA to find new anticancer agents Their interaction studies are attempted by UV-Vis spectroscopy, electrochemical techniques, and gel electrophoresis
